Snodland Train Station offers an array of services tailored to make your journey seamless. The ticket office is operational from Monday to Friday between 06:00 and 12:30, ensuring you can grab your tickets early in the day. Additionally, ticket machines are conveniently located at the station, letting you collect pre-purchased tickets or purchase new ones on the go. These are accessible for all users, ensuring ease of use for everyone.
If you need assistance while at the station, staff support is available during weekday mornings. For travelers requiring extra help, assistance can be pre-booked or requested on the day. The station is equipped with necessary facilities such as an induction loop and accessible toilets, making it friendly for all travelers. However, refreshment facilities and ATMs are not available on-site, so plan accordingly.
Well-integrated with local public transport, Snodland Station provides various onward travel options for your convenience. Taxis can be accessed right in front of the station, and a rail replacement service is available at the station entrance. Situated in the heart of the charming town of Linlithgow, just 20 miles west of Edinburgh, Linlithgow train station serves as a key gateway to a wealth of Scottish locales. Whether you're a local heading into the city for work, a student, or a traveler exploring Scotland, the station offers a blend of essential amenities and convenient transport links to make your journey smooth and enjoyable.
The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late at night, ensuring that you can always secure a ticket for your travels. For those who prefer online booking, ticket collection is facilitated by accessible ticket machines located at the station. Moreover, for passengers with hearing impairments,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ility.
Independently navigating the station is straightforward due to the comprehensive step-free access provided throughout. Despite having no accessible toilets, the station offers waiting rooms on both platforms where travelers can also access public Wi-Fi. If you're looking to grab a quick refreshment, a coffee vending machine is on hand to cater to your caffeine needs before you embark on your journey.
Linlithgow station boasts substantial connectivity with various modes of transport ensuring seamless travel. Should railway services be disrupted, a rail replacement service operates with buses picking up passengers from High Street. For detailed information about bus services, visit Traveline Scotland or call their 24-hour hotline. Taxi services are equally accessible, with details available at TrainTaxi.
Parking is hassle-free with a no-charge policy, as there are 96 parking spaces available, inclusive of two blue badge spaces. Cyclists are also catered to with a covered bicycle storage area accommodating up to 38 bikes, protected by CCTV for enhanced security.
